Charlie and Sarah are two teens who are both suffering depression for their own reasons. They meet in an on-line chat room. They decide they want to rid the world of criminals, rapists and pedophiles etc. So they come up with a plan for the "suicidal teens". If they are going to take their own lives then they should "take one with you" (meaning kill a bad person). Basically it would be a homicide/suicide. Soon it goes viral and things get out of control.
